Mission
Refer to schedule o.summit montessori school is a community dedicated to developing respectful, self-motivated, life-long learners through a challenging, individualized, montessori-based curriculum. The children cultivate their strengths to reach their unique potential and to become active participants in the global community.
Programs
1 program
After-school and summer programs - after-school care provides enriching, extended school hours for those children who enroll. The explorations program provides opportunities to explore activities such as art or other various programs in-depth. In addition, the school further extended its hours to provide an early-care option for parents providing the same enriching environment as the after-school care program. The summer program provides the children with a summer camp experience. This program includes both indoor and outdoor activities, as well as field trips.
